Transaction 41133cea0ebb50afa1cde9c0eb19752e3829dc8c80121428f551d95b16052734

1 Input
2 Outputs
  • 41133cea0ebb50afa1cde9c0eb19752e3829dc8c80121428f551d95b16052734:0
  • value  2874509
    address  34zenEa2gVkn4kSm3hQunWAshYMqjy3RHk
  • 41133cea0ebb50afa1cde9c0eb19752e3829dc8c80121428f551d95b16052734:1
  • value  88387589
    address  372cDA1RZJhzcMMwpnPZD1NbWzDhK4e2dA